Abstract

In this paper, the operating conditions of electrocoagulation (EC) for the treatment of oilfield wastewater were investigated. The static experimental results showed that current density and electrolysis time had a significant impact on the treatment. Current density 3.97 mA·cm-2, plate spacing 10 mm and pH 7.2 were selected as operating conditions, and after 40 min EC experiment, the oily wastewater, the initial oil content was 632 mg·L-1,had been well treated, and the oil removal rate could reach to 68.08%. The continuous experimental results showed that the oil removal rate could reach to 85.7%, and the oil concentration of effluent was 92.7 mg·L-1 under the operating conditions as follows: HRT (hydraulic retention time) 40 min, current density of EC tank 3.70 mA·cm2, current density of electro-flotation tank 3.30 mA·cm-2, initial pH 7.2, and plate spacing 10 mm.
